Quoted from Grantham_Mariner
So, correct me if I have got things wrong......

Because of his age and the fact that Mansfield have offered him a contract a fee is payable, either by agreement or tribunal.

But what happens when Palmer stops being paid by Mansfield, but is unable to sign for us (or another) because they do not or will not pay a fee. He will have no income unless he signs what sounds like a poor offer by Mansfield.

This is a very poor situation for any young footballer!


No. The offer is not a poor one, it has to be higher than his previous contract for Mansfield to be eligible to a fee. The sticking point, I would imagine, is that Mansfield have signed three strikers in a week so he might not even get on the bench most weeks and at 23 that isn't doing your career any favours. If he doesn't sign for Mansfield, we can sign him but would owe Mansfield a fee. However, as he's only been there 2 years and they sent him out on loan, it would probably not be all that much.
